Introduction to Omagh, Northern Ireland
Omagh is often associated with the violence of the devastating 1998 IRA bombings that left 29 dead. But the town itself dates back to 1610 and has a nice range of historic buildings in the downtown area, and the scenic River Strule runs through it. There are numerous public parks in the city, the best of which is Grange Park near the city centre. Omagh Leisure Complex lies along the river nearby Grange Park, offering people 26 acres of landscaped grounds, a lake, cycle paths and recreational facilities. Ten miles north of town is Gortin Glens Forest Park, a lovely wooded area with lakes, waterfalls, walking trails and a deer park. Omagh's town centre is slowly being revitalised with projects like Strule Arts Centre. High Street is the place to go for shopping, dining and a pub or two, while modern shopping complexes such as the Main Street Mall are close by. Hotels in Omagh come in many price categories and levels of comfort. Most are practical mid-range hotels, though a few upscale historic inns can be found in the older sections of town.
